This Wednesday, Paris Saint-Germain take on Liverpool at the Parc des Princes in the first leg of the 2025-2026 Champions League quarter-finals (return leg on April 14) (kick-off at 9 pm, live on Canal+). On Tuesday evening, Le Parisien put forward a likely Parisian lineup.
Kvaratskhelia – Dembélé – Doué
Neves – Vitinha – Zaïre-Emery
Mendes – Pacho – Marquinhos – Hakimi
Safonov.
It is a perfectly credible lineup, but caution is still needed since coach Luis Enrique does not give any hints to the media. We have to try to guess his choices amid fierce competition and a certain degree of versatility. Even if a “typical starting XI” is beginning to emerge in the Champions League, where no rotation is expected.
So there are a few choices that seem fairly certain, such as the defense. But there are still options in midfield and attack. We will therefore wait for the official announcement, around 1 hour before the match, in order to be sure.
